Why Middle Village’s Climate & Housing Affect Damage Restoration
Middle Village’s dominant housing stock is attached and semi-detached brick row houses, most built between 1940 and 1965, with finished or semi-finished basements that have often been converted to rental units or in-law suites. That means when water intrudes, it’s not soaking a mechanical room; it’s destroying furnished living space, sometimes with a tenant’s belongings inside. Restoration scope and insurance complexity both jump accordingly.
The neighborhood’s interior Queens location doesn’t protect it from flooding. Middle Village sits atop aging combined sewer infrastructure that backs up during the intense summer thunderstorms the NYC metro keeps getting. Ida’s remnants in September 2021 inundated finished basement living spaces across central Queens, and Middle Village took its share. Winter adds a different problem: freeze-thaw cycles stress original brick mortar and parapet walls on these mid-century homes, opening small but persistent pathways for water that feed recurring mold problems behind walls and under baseboards.
Pricing for Damage Restoration in Middle Village
Restoration pricing depends on square footage affected, material removal required, and drying time, but Middle Village homeowners should expect these honest ranges:
- Water extraction and drying: $1,800-$4,500 for a typical finished basement event
- Mold remediation: $2,000-$6,000 for a contained 200-400 square foot project
- Sewage cleanup: $2,500-$7,000 depending on contamination spread
- Fire and smoke restoration: $4,000-$25,000+ depending on structural involvement
